13 Residents Drown While Fleeing Gunmen in Zamfara
Thirteen residents of Birnin Magaji ward in Zamfara State have drowned while attempting to escape an armed attack on Friday.
According to eyewitnesses, gunmen stormed two communities in the area, forcing residents to flee toward a nearby river. With only one boat available, dozens of people tried to board, causing it to capsize.
Shehu Mohammed, a health worker in Birnin Magaji, said his eldest son and two nieces were among the victims.
“My eldest son and two other nieces were among the 13 people who died when the boat was heavily overloaded with people,” he told Reuters.
Maidamma Dankilo, the district head of Birnin Magaji, confirmed the casualty figures. He said 22 residents were rescued, while 22 others remain missing.
The incident underscores the growing insecurity in Zamfara, where communities have faced repeated assaults from armed groups.
Just last week, gunmen killed two residents and abducted at least 100 in Gamdum Mallam and Ruwan Rana villages of Bukkuyum Local Government Area. Earlier in August, attacks in Kauran Namoda LGA left 24 people dead, 16 injured, and 144 kidnapped. In July, bandits killed 33 abductees in Banga town after allegedly collecting a ransom of ₦50 million.
Zamfara remains one of the states hardest hit by banditry in northern Nigeria, with residents often caught between fleeing for safety and facing further tragedy.
